Overview
Penola Primary School is a government primary school in Penola, South Australia, serving R-6. The school has 133 enrolled students. Its ICSEA value is 977 (average). The student-to-teacher ratio is 9.6:1. The school is located in a SEIFA IRSD decile 2 area.
